Re: Capability of Disklavier 4

2010-07-18 by Joan

I only have one of these a Norah Jones floppy disk that I purchased that would play the piano.  I had the same regular audio CD that went with this.  

I think it is this type of Pianosoft that is on the Yamaha page (URL below).  I doubt that these are actually played by the artist.  

http://www.yamahamusicsoft.com/en/category/PianoSoft/catalog?group=Smart+PianoSoft

If you click on any of these titles on the above URL, you will see that they also list a link to buy the audio CD from Amazon.  I think these are the ones you are referencing.

Even though these reference Mark III model of disklavier, I believe this is what I purchased and it worked with my Mark IV.  

Possibly calling or sending an email to Yamaha to ask about original artist floppies would be your best bet in finding some.  I know that there are a few artists that do record in the Yamaha studios.
